The Riskiest Business Model No One Talks About

Why Relying on One Income Source Is Costing You More Than You Think

Let’s start with a truth that may challenge everything you’ve been taught:

The riskiest business model is not entrepreneurship but dependence. More specifically…a 9-5 job. It is the riskiest business model because it has exactly one customer. One source, one paycheck, and one decision-maker controlling your income.

And yet, many people feel safer there than building something of their own. But is that truly safety… or just familiarity?

The Illusion of Job Security

We’ve been conditioned to believe that job security equals stability. But in reality, layoffs happen, budgets shift, companies restructure and suddenly, what felt secure becomes uncertain. “Job security” is often a comforting story we tell ourselves but the Bible reminds us in Proverbs 22:29: “Do you see someone skilled in their work? They will serve before kings; they will not serve before obscure men.”

Notice what the scripture emphasizes: Not the job or the title. But the skill. Your true security is not your employer.
It is your ability. 

Skill Development Is the Real Currency

In today’s world, skills are leverage. The more valuable your skills are, the more opportunities you create. The problem is not that people lack potential. It’s that many have not developed or packaged their skills in a way that creates income. Many professionals already have valuable skills. They just haven’t monetized them.

Skills like communication, strategy, content creation, data analysis, coaching, problem-solving aren’t just job functions, they are income streams waiting to be activated.

The Power of Skill Monetization

One of the biggest shifts happening today is this:

People are no longer just offering services. They are productizing their skills and building personal brands. 

Instead of trading time for money, they are creating:

  • Digital products
  • Courses
  • Memberships
  • Consulting frameworks
  • Automated systems

And with tools like AI, this becomes even more accessible. The real leverage comes when you turn your skills into scalable systems.

Real-Life Examples of Skill-Based Businesses

Here’s what is happening everyday: 

Sandra, a travel creator hosts free webinars that lead to paid masterminds and affiliate income. Jose, a language academy owner builds a team of instructors and offers global payment plans. Laura, a coach creates offers ranging from $37 to $1500. Paul, a golf coach turns guides into retreats and premium sessions. Jenna, a nail educator builds recurring income through memberships. Maria, a credit educator scales offers from free to $5000 programs. Izzy, a therapist offers structured sessions. Franca, a career coach builds tiered coaching programs.

Different industries, but the same principle: Skills + Structure = Scalable Income

Why One Income Stream Is Not Enough

Relying on a single income source is not just limiting but it’s also risky. Income fragility is real. And yet, many people believe building a side income is “too risky.”

But the truth is: Not building one is even riskier. Ecclesiastes 11:2 says: “Invest in seven ventures, yes, in eight; you do not know what disaster may come upon the land.” Biblically, diversification is wisdom.
